Product Recommendation Chatbot : Converse, Recommend, Sell & Repeat

Product Recommendation Chatbot : Converse, Recommend, Sell & Repeat

Product recommendation isn’t something new. Offline retailers have been practising this smart method for many years to sell and earn more. However, with buyers shifting towards online commerce, it has become inevitable to implement such techniques on your e-commerce platform. So, you can pitch relevant products to buyers as per their search history and product preferences. Hence, you get better sales and a higher ROI. 

To enable product recommendation on your e-commerce channel, you can implement A.I. chatbots or specific product recommendation engines.

This brings us to discuss how these technologies work and why you should implement them with your online marketplace. 

E-commerce Chatbot: What is it and What can it Do? 

When you assist customers in making the right decision about products, they are more likely to return and shop again.

The rise of e-commerce platforms can be dedicated to the next-gen technologies that have helped them reach millions of buyers and gain their trust as well. For instance, as an early adopter of eCommerce chatbots, online stores have simplified the process of answering repeated queries of buyers in real-time. Hence, promoting them to buy products.

But, what exactly is an eCommerce chatbot?

In layman terms, an eCommerce chatbot is a virtual assistant that can interpret buyers' requirements and assist them accordingly. It can help users with their queries, and recommend relevant products, take their feedback, raise a return/refund ticket, etc. 

Above all, a chatbot can collect enormous user data from thousands of customers and present it to your marketing and sales team. The ability of chatbots to save user preferences can also be employed to personalize the buyer’s experience. A chatbot can recommend products to shoppers based on recent shopping activity, search history, product preferences, demographics, etc.

Product recommendation via AI chatbots can prove to be the easiest way to uplift the tardy sales. That’s why e-commerce platforms, such as Amazon, Flipkart, and Grofers, have already applied this strategy in their online portals. 

How can A Chatbot Recommend Products to Buyers?

With their conversational user interface and ability to work around the clock, chatbots make it easier for businesses to up-sell and cross-sell products. 

Chatbots are famously known for their ability to answer the repeated queries of buyers. But, they can do more than this. For instance, while assisting the users with their product related queries, it can also ask predefined questions and save their preferences. 

The same user data can be applied to sort available products and display the most relevant ones. 

Types of Product Recommendations A Chatbot can Offer

Product recommendation happens in real-time; therefore, it’s essential to understand "In how many ways can you promote products via a chatbot?" 

Based on your business requirements, you can route product recommendations, respectively. A product can be referred to buyers on many factors and scenarios, such as: 

1. Previously searched products recommendations

Less than 20% of users visit online stores with the intention of buying. It implies that on their first visit, most buyers Reece products and offers. So they can find the best one from an online store. However, when finding the most suitable item, buyers forget about the previously searched products. 

A chatbot can remember the recent searches of buyers, and when it senses that buyers have moved past to what they have earlier searched, it displays the same products within the chat window. 

P.S.: This strategy is most suitable when buyers don’t add any product in the cart

2. Similar products recommendations

Displaying similar products to buyers is one of the most common product recommendation practices. But, it should be done delicately as buyers might get confused about which product to buy! Eventually, this might lead to the abandonment of the cart. Therefore, before you display similar products to buyers, make sure that they are willing to find related items. 

A chatbot can do this more interactively with its conversational U.I. It can ask shoppers if they are interested in similar products and provide them “Yes,” “No,” as options. Now, based on the user intent, a chatbot can recommend relevant products. 

P.S.: This strategy is most suitable when items added in the customer’s cart get out of stock

3. Add-on products recommendations

It is a particular type of product recommendation, as you can only push products that go with the ones that buyers have already added into their cart. Having said that, when you smartly craft add-on product recommendations, it can also remarkably uplift customer experience. For instance, when a buyer adds shoes in their cart, it will be right to recommend a pair of socks. 

A chatbot can do this better than non-communicative product recommendation channels. At first, it can complement buyers for adding shoes in their cart, then pitch them with an offer and a pair of socks. By communicating the proposal, a chatbot boosts not only sales but also customer experience. 

P.S.: Recommend products that add value to the ones that customers are already buying

4. High margin products recommendations

By recommending high margin products over the ones that a buyer has selected, you can increase sales tenfold. Also, as buyers aren’t aware of how much margin you make on each product, you can easily sell products that return higher ROI. 

When this is done via chatbot, you can also answer the buyers' queries regarding the promoted products. Hence, it increases the chances of closing the deal. 

P.S.: While going for higher-margin, don’t refer low-quality products to buyers. Otherwise, it might result in poor customer experience.  

5. Bestsellers recommendations

Other than the product recommendation strategy, it’s always a great idea to tell the world about what your customer love the most to buy. On the other hand, it’s always a good beginning for new customers to scroll through bestsellers that they are likely to add in cart.

With the help of conversational chatbots, bestseller recommendations can be empowered in a personalized way. 

P.S.: Before you begin displaying bestseller recommendation, consider asking buyers about the category that they want to explore. 

6. Trending products recommendations

Employ real-time user data to attract more buyers in the sales funnel. You can make use of website search data to build a list of such items. Moreover, this product recommendation strategy can further help get an in-depth understanding of buyers’ preferences when pushed via chatbots.  

P.S.: Always segment buyers before displaying trending items so that you can hit the right audience. 

7. New arrivals recommendations

People are always interested in learning about new products and launches. This human behaviour can be leveraged to boost your sales in the right direction. With the help of conversational chatbots, you can also answer buyers' queries regarding products in real-time. 

P.S.: Promote new arrivals from the same category from which a buyer is searching for products. 

8. Geographic and demographic-based recommendations

eCommerce chatbot can save user name, age, gender, location, and product preferences of buyers. The same data can be employed to target buyers and pitch products that people from the same region are buying. 

P.S.: Before suggesting products, always ask the buyer’s preferences. So you can personalize the user experience while promoting products. 

9. Seasonal product recommendations

To provide buyers with seasonal product recommendations, you need first to train your chatbot with the same information. For doing so, you’ll need to sort products as per their seasonal usages. For instance, it will be right to recommend buyers with products like umbrellas and raincoats during monsoon. 

Benefits of Product Recommendation Chatbot

1. Upsell Products

By promoting products that are priced higher than the ones that a buyer has already picked, you can increase your revenue per customer. However, doing the same isn’t an easy task. 

It's where a chatbot can assist online businesses. It can brief buyers about the differences between the two products and why one is better than other. Hence, it saves time of the buyers and promotes them to make a decision quickly. 

2. Cross-sell Products

Cross-selling of products is considered a daunting task. Because not every buyer is interested in buying an additional product. This can be changed, as buyers don’t add a product in their cart until they know what it’s for. As, when you recommend cross-sell products via chatbot, and educate buyers about the additional products. It gets more natural for them to grab the information and make the purchase. 

3. Improve Customer Experience

Browsing through online stores can be challenging for buyers. This scenario can be changed with virtual assistants. By deploying a chatbot on your eCommerce website, you can assist buyers as they land on it. A bot can answer their queries and also ask specific questions to aid them accordingly. 

Indeed, this means with Product Recommendation Chatbot; you can kill two birds with one stone. 

4. Boost average order value

By prompting additional products to the buyers, Product Recommendation Chatbot can help increase the average order value. This metric plays a vital role in boosting the profitability of online businesses. To put it in simple words, an increase in average order value can help retailers cover customer acquisition costs. 

5. Learn about individual customer preferences

Product Recommendation Chatbot, while assisting buyers with their queries, saves their inputs. This information can be leveraged to build effective marketing and product promotion campaigns. 

How to Know if Product Recommendation is Going Right?

When done correctly via chatbot, product recommendations can lead to the manifold growth of your eCommerce platform. Therefore, you should keep an eye on whether it’s moving in the right direction or not!

Here are some ways, you can make sure that your products recommendations are practical and relevant: 

1. Track metrics

Check for vital metrics, such as average session time, number of product visits, user actions (Add to cart, wishlist, etc.) to determine the effectiveness of Product Recommendation Chatbot. 

2. Compare sales data 

Whenever you revise your product recommendation strategy, you should compare the new sales data with the old one. This will give you a more comprehensive understanding of how to recommend products effectively and offers to get the maximum profit. 

3. Check conversational flow

It would help if you kept optimizing the chatbot’s conversational flow over time. But most importantly, you need to check for conversational turns where most of the buyers are leaving the chat. By working on such points, you can limit the drop-offs. And, ultimately boost sales

Things to Keep in Mind While Recommending Products via Chatbot

Although you can wholly automate the product recommendation via chatbots, you should keep in mind some important factors to save yourself from delivering bad customer experience. 

1. Product recommendation should be contextual:

While promoting products to individual buyers, stay relevant as much as possible. So, buyers get a sense of reasonable customer support assistance from your brand. 

2. Don’t overstuff product recommendations:

Always keep item recommendations limited. Otherwise, buyers might get confused in deciding which product is best for them. 

3. Display available items: 

Last but not least, you should connect product recommendation chatbot with inventory, so before promoting it, bot can check if it’s is available or not.

Web/app-based Product Recommendation vs Chatbot-based Product Recommendation

As we have discussed, what is product recommendation, how it works, types, and tips? Let’s move forward to learn how chatbot based suggestions are different from the website.

In general, Product recommendation engines analyze tons of user data, such as behavioural data, collaborative data, demographics data, search data, etc. to create and display a list of products that are relevant to buyers.

Undoubtedly, by implementing a product recommendation engine, you can magnify sales, revenue, and customer experience. However, to get the most out of your product recommendation strategy, you’ll need a virtual assistant that can help buyers with their queries regarding promoted products. Besides this, a chatbot can voice your product recommendations and boost their reach by manifolds. Hence, higher chances of closing deals.

3 Ways to Begin with Product Recommendations

Undoubtedly by connecting your eCommerce with a product recommendation engine, you can effectively boost product sales. There are three ways you can do this: 

1. Integrate Product Recommendation Engine with your eCommerce website

You can buy a Reco tool from the vendor and directly integrate it with your online marketplace. It is the easiest way to get started with product recommendations. 

2. Integrate Product Recommendation Engine with eCommerce Chatbot

Implementing a conversational strategy along with your product recommendations can do wonders. So, if you have already connected a Reco engine with your website, you can integrate it with the chatbot via APIs. 

3. Build a Product Recommendation Chatbot for your eCommerce website

Besides the two points mentioned above, building a chatbot for your eCommerce is the most feasible way to get started with product recommendations.  However, you’ll need to create chatbot’s conversational flow for the same. Also, the bot will need necessary training upfront, such as when to display a product, what actions to take when a buyer visits a particular page, etc. 

Traditional Product Recommendation Engines V/s Conversational Product Recommendation Chatbots

A chatbot can provide the same product recommendations as of Reco engines. It can employ the same strategies to filter and display relevant items to buyers. Overall, in terms of their ability to provide product recommendations, standalone tools and chatbots are indistinguishable. 

However, chatbots are made to take it further with their conversational interface. Apart from showing suggestions, chatbots can also assist buyers with their queries as they ask. 

Now, what differentiates the two is the ability of chatbots to not only display products but also assist buyers with the same as they ask a query. In addition, with eCommerce chatbot, you can: 

  1. Converse with buyers regarding recommended items
  2. Take buyers feedback wrt to recommendations
  3. Ask specific questions to understand the relevancy of products
  4. Get better insights about your product recommendation strategy
  5. Get a detailed overview of the performance of product recommendation campaign


Taking into account the benefits of Product Recommendation Chatbot for your online businesses, it can prove to be beneficial in the effective growth of your platform. However, as there are multiple recommendation strategies, it’ll be good to keep experimenting with them on your audience base. Also, you can segment buyers to test different product recommendation approaches. 

Book a free demo with our chatbot experts and learn how Product Recommendation Chatbot can do wonders for your eCommerce business.

Lastly, remember, the best chatbot is simply the one that is useful for your users and allows you to automate repetitive tasks, so that you can focus on scaling your business faster!

So, what are you waiting for? Build something awesome today!

  • Copied

Best Chatbot Templates By Industry


Insurance Chatbot

Deploy Makerobos insurance chatbot to autonomously handle insurance-related concerns of your customers. Use cha ...


Finance Chatbot

Finance chatbot will serve as financial advisor guiding anything from investing money in properties to buying a ...


Banking Chatbot

Banking institutions can easily train Makerobos chatbot with millions of questions frequently asked by customer ...


Education Chatbot

Makerobos education chatbot can be designed to help students, college/university groups, and teachers to commun ...


Coaching Chatbot

In coaching business, time, funds, and resources are typically limited. The pros of having a chatbot available ...


Manufacturing Chatbot

The manufacturing industry heavily relies on supply chain management and to glean all such vital information li ...


Railway Train Chatbot

While traveling on wheels, passengers often need information on schedules, fares, platform allocations, etc. Ma ...


Airline Chatbot

While being frequent flier, passengers often need information on schedules, fares, boarding pass, arrival and d ...


Tax Chatbot

Incorporating tax chatbot by tax management agencies can be real game changer allowing their clients to track e ...


Automobile Chatbot

The car dealer chatbot can help automotive industry in multiple ways for instance let the chatbot be the offici ...


Hospitality Chatbot

Makerobos hospitality chatbot can be real game changer for businesses operating in hospitality sector by transf ...


Event Management Chatbot

One of the nice feature of chatbot is its ability to aid in event management. It can designed to show booking d ...


Consultancy Chatbot

Are you into consulting business? Makerobos consultancy chatbot can free-up yourself from monotonous & mundane ...


Legal Chatbot

Makerobos legal chatbots deployed on law firm websites can help automate certain time consuming processes like ...


HR Chatbot

AI-powered Makerobos HR chatbot can offer instant response to work related queries thereby harmonizing HR — emp ...


Recruitment Chatbot

Change the way your business interacts with talent. Deploy Makerobos recruitment chatbot to keep candidates eng ...


Restaurant Chatbot

Customer retention and loyalty are two important core values for any service based industry and so it’s paramou ...


Information Technology Chatbot

An IT help desk in most organisations is considered as customer-facing portal for the entire IT department. Any ...


E-commerce Chatbot

Create Makerobos chatbot for your e-commerce store to solve queries of your customers, buy your products straig ...


Retail Chatbot

Messaging chatbots are great for the retail industry unlike humans who are time-bound. Chatbots can offer inces ...


Digital Marketing Chatbot

Chatbots are most efficient in gathering information, qualifying leads and setting your sales team up for meeti ...


Survey Chatbot

Conventionally businesses have always relied on survey forms and call centers to collect customer feedback. Mak ...


Healthcare Chatbot

Makerobos healthcare chatbot can help both healthcare providers and patients. The bot can quickly and easily co ...


Customer Care Chatbot

Deploy Makerobos customer care chatbot to easily infer customer questions, provide answers, push help articles ...


News Chatbot

Millions of news readers everyday use some sort of communication channel to see what’s happening in the world a ...


B2B Chatbot

B2B marketing chatbot is the next big thing allowing businesses to qualify leads, gather information on custome ...


Real Estate Chatbot

Imagine availability of 24/7 real estate virtual agent greeting website visitors to provide property details, i ...


Travel Chatbot

Chatbots and travel makes a perfect partnership! In fact chatbots are real game changers for this industry. Mak ...

Talk to Bot Expert Right-arrow

We would love you to answer your questions about product capabilities, solution benefits, platform features, pricing or anything else.

Contact us to know how Makerobos products and solutions can provide an enriched experience to your employees, customers, and agents. Our next-gen intelligent virtual assistant technology has helped hundreds of enterprise customers across the globe to satisfy the growing demand for self-service, reduce operational costs, and increase revenue. You can be next!

I consent to receive relevant email communication from Makerobos in accordance with the Privacy Policy and understand I can opt-out at any time